At its core, the Laser Vision Seam Tracking System uses advanced laser technology to monitor and adjust the position of machinery in real time. This system is especially beneficial in industries like textiles, automotive, and construction, where seamless joining of materials is critical. By providing continuous feedback about seam alignment, it helps ensure that products meet strict quality standards.
One of the most significant advantages of the Laser Vision Seam Tracking System is its ability to achieve precise alignment. Traditional methods often rely on manual adjustments or fixed machinery settings, which can lead to inconsistencies. In contrast, the laser system continuously scans the workpiece and makes instantaneous adjustments, ensuring that every seam is perfectly aligned.
Example: Imagine a textile factory producing garments. The Laser Vision Seam Tracking System can accurately follow the curves and contours of the fabric, resulting in flawlessly stitched seams that enhance the garment's overall quality.
Quality improvement doesn’t just mean better final products; it also includes minimizing waste. With traditional seam alignment methods, mistakes often lead to fabric or material being discarded. The Laser Vision Seam Tracking System reduces errors significantly, which translates to less wasted material and lower production costs.

Incorporating the Laser Vision Seam Tracking System can also speed up production times. With machines operating at optimal efficiency and requiring less manual oversight, production teams can increase output without sacrificing quality. This efficiency allows companies to meet market demands more effectively, a crucial factor in today’s competitive landscape.

Another benefit is the enhancement of quality control processes. The laser system offers real-time data monitoring and feedback, allowing quality control teams to identify issues on the fly. This proactive approach ensures that potential defects are addressed before products reach the market, ultimately leading to higher customer satisfaction.
Example: Think about a manufacturer of automotive parts. With the Laser Vision Seam Tracking System, any slight misalignment can be detected and corrected instantly, preventing defective parts from being shipped.
